Erdos's Conjecture on Consecutive Integers Free of Certain Prime Factors
Let $n_k$ be the least $n > 2k$ such that $(n-k)(n-k+1)\cdots(n-1)$ has no prime factor in $(k, 2k)$. Erdos conjectured a superpolynomial lower bound; for all large $k$, $n_k > e^{\log^2 k / (20 \log\log k)}$.
